#357c9d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#357c9d is composed of 20.8% red, 48.6% green and 61.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 66.2% cyan, 21% magenta, 0% yellow and 38.4% black. It has a hue angle of 199 degrees, a saturation of 49.5% and a lightness of 41.2%. #357c9d color hex could be obtained by blending #6af8ff with #00003b. Closest websafe color is: #336699.

Shades and Tints of #357c9d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#03080a is the darkest color, while #fbfdf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#357c9d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#656a6d is the less saturated color, while #058ecd is the most saturated one.
